According to the Canadian Leisure & Reading Study 2024, across all formats and across all subjects and genres, in 2024, 19% of Canadians read comics, manga, or graphic novels. How did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els titles perform during the second quarter of 2025? We find out with the help of our SalesData and LibraryData services.
Buying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els
Compared to 2024, the overall sales of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els titles were up 7% over the entire second quarter. Looking at the graph below, sales of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els decreased by 4% from April to June 2025. In the second quarter of 2024, sales of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els were up by 1%.
These are the BISAC subcategories with the highest year-over-year increase in sales:
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Asian American & Pacific Islander — up 16,900%
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Slice of Life — up 524%
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Food — up 500%
From April to June 2025, the most purchased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els subcategories were:
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/ East Asian Style — 67%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els sales
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Superheroes — 8%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els sales
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Fantasy — 7%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els sales
Borrowing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els
From April to June 2025, library loans of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els titles were up 11% and renewals were up 8% when compared with the same time period in 2024.
Year-over-year, loans increased by 6% in April, 16% in May, and 9% in June. Overall, loans increased by 3% in the second quarter of 2024 and increased by 6% in the second quarter of 2025.
Year-over-year, renewals increased by 10% in April, 6% in May, and 7% in June. Overall, renewals decreased by 3% in the second quarter of 2024 and decreased by 5% in the second quarter of 2025.
Which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els BISAC subcategories were the most popular in Canadian public libraries? From April to June 2025, these subcategories saw the greatest increases in library circulation compared to 2024:
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/ European Style (incl. Bandes Dessinées) — loans up 132% and renewals up 650%
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Coming of Age — loans up 364% and renewals up 209%
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Food — loans up 164% and renewals up 13%
During the second quarter of 2025, the most circulated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els subcategories were:
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/ East Asian Style — 53%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els loans and 49%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els renewals
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Superheroes — 13%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els loans and 15%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els renewals
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els / Fantasy — 7%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els loans and 7% of all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els renewals
Reading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els
Here are the top selling and top borrowed Non-Fiction / Comics & Graphic Novels titles from the second quarter of 2025.
Top borrowed
Jujutsu Kaisen series by Gege Akutami
My Hero Academia series by Kohei Horikoshi
Demon Slayer: Kimetsu No Yaiba series by Koyoharu Gotouge
Naruto series by Masashi Kishimoto
One Piece series by Eiichiro Oda
Top selling
Jujutsu Kaisen, Vol. 26 by Gege Akutami
Solo Leveling, Vol. 12 (comic) by Chugong
Chainsaw Man, Vol. 18 by Tatsuki Fujimoto
Jujutsu Kaisen, Vol. 25 by Gege Akutami
JoJo's Bizarre Adventure: Part 7--Steel Ball Run, Vol. 1 by Hirohiko Araki
